This person's birth year is 1938. The age of Ned is 85. He has stayed in Toledo, Saint Petersburg, Richmond and 2 other cities before moving to St Petersburg. Ned’s residency is at 2001 59Th Way, St Petersburg, Fl 33710. Ned's possible relatives are Joseph G Montgomery, Leta Lee Montgomery, Nicci L Montgomery and 3 other people. Phone number listed for Ned is (727) 347-7489.